Laura Ashley online sales grow by more than a fifth

This is an archived article - we have removed images and other assets but have left the text unchanged for your reference

Laura Ashley today reported an autumnal boost to its ecommerce sales of more than a fifth, thanks to expansion in m-commerce and overseas.

The fashion retailer said ecommerce sales grew by 22.6% in the 19 weeks to December 8, as total retail sales increased by 4.2% and like-for-like sales by 4.9%.

“The introduction of a mobile site that offers the complete range of our products, and increased overseas deliveries, have both been instrumental in this growth,” the company said in today’s interim management statement.
